Understanding ePOD and its role in supply chain management:
Electronic Proof of Delivery (ePOD) is a digital solution that allows businesses to track and manage their deliveries in real-time. It captures key information such as delivery time, location, and recipient’s signature, providing businesses with a proof of completion for their deliveries. In supply chain management, ePOD plays a crucial role in improving efficiency and visibility.

By using ePOD, businesses can streamline their delivery processes, reduce paperwork and manual errors, and gain real-time visibility into their supply chain. This helps them make informed decisions, improve customer satisfaction, and ultimately increase their bottom line.

Benefits of using ePOD in supply chain management:
The use of ePOD brings numerous benefits to supply chain management. Firstly, it eliminates the need for manual paperwork and data entry, reducing the chances of human errors and delays in delivery. This not only saves time but also improves the accuracy of data, leading to better decision-making.

Secondly, ePOD allows for real-time tracking of deliveries, providing businesses with up-to-date information on their shipment’s status and location. This helps businesses anticipate and mitigate any potential delays or issues, leading to better customer service and improved on-time delivery performance.

Furthermore, ePOD can also help businesses comply with industry regulations and standards. By providing a digital proof of delivery, businesses can ensure that their deliveries are properly documented, reducing the risk of non-compliance and potential penalties.

Item 4: Integration with transportation management systems (TMS):
Transportation management systems (TMS) play a critical role in managing and optimizing transportation operations in the supply chain. By integrating ePOD with TMS, businesses can streamline their transportation processes and improve overall supply chain efficiency.

One of the main benefits of integrating ePOD with TMS is improved transportation planning and execution. With real-time data sharing between the two systems, businesses can have a better understanding of their delivery schedules, routes, and vehicle capacity. This allows for more accurate and efficient transportation planning, reducing the risk of delays and increasing on-time delivery rates.

In addition, ePOD can also provide valuable data to TMS, such as proof of delivery, delivery times, and signatures. This data can be used to track and monitor delivery performance, identify areas for improvement, and make data-driven decisions for future transportation planning.

However, integrating ePOD with TMS also comes with its own set of challenges. One of the main challenges is ensuring seamless integration between the two systems. This requires careful planning and consideration of factors such as data formats, communication protocols, and data synchronization methods.

To overcome these challenges, businesses can use middleware solutions or application programming interfaces (APIs) to facilitate data exchange between ePOD and TMS. These integration methods ensure that data is accurately and efficiently shared between the two systems, improving overall supply chain visibility and efficiency.

In conclusion, integration between ePOD and TMS is crucial for businesses looking to optimize their transportation operations and improve supply chain efficiency. By leveraging the benefits of real-time data sharing and accurate information exchange, businesses can achieve better transportation planning and execution, leading to cost savings and improved customer satisfaction.
